Valterra Platinum, formerly Anglo-American Platinum, is a leading primary producer of platinum group metals (PGMs), with integrated mining, smelting, and refining operations in South Africa and Zimbabwe, marketing the metal we produce globally. Following our demerger from Anglo American plc, Valterra Platinum is now an independent, publicly listed company with a primary and secondary listing on the Johannesburg and London stock exchanges respectively.

Job responsibilities include (but are not limited to):
• Support the Work Management process by ensuring that all required resources for Approved Work are identified on the Work Order
•  Execute the “Plan Work” element of Work Management in the Operating Model and the Asset Management Framework.
• Comply with quality specifications and authority levels set out in the documentation
• Review the Work Order Task Status Report daily: To assist in prioritizing the planning work/ To track upcoming work
• Plan approved work orders (within area of responsibility) for resource provisioning and execution prior to the Required Date.
• Encourage contribution of planning details from those expected to do the work.
• Incorporate crew input into planning packages.
•  Identify and escalate all critical issues that threaten the successful planning of work orders for completion by their required date.
• Plan work to minimize the impact on operating performance without exceeding the required date for work completion.
• Plan work to minimize the demand for resources without exceeding the Required Date for work completion
• Comply with applicable legislation, standards, policies and procedures.
• Develop and use standard jobs to improve the efficiency of the planning process
